Thanks to the grace of God, a fruitful collaboration between Al-Yar’aa Syrian and Al-Furqan Institute, affiliated with the Directorate of Awqaf in Qabasin and its countryside, has had a positive impact on our children’s Arabic language learning.
For the past three months, we have been working with pre-primary children in Qabasin, implementing the Al-Yar’aa Syrian Arabic Language Program, designed to help children master reading and writing in Arabic. This is achieved through a curriculum that relies on innovative methods and supportive tools tailored to achieve this goal.
